Abstract

The utility model discloses a multifunctional medical care chair, which comprises a wheelchair bracket, wherein a seat cushion is arranged on the wheelchair bracket, a shaft is rotatably arranged on the wheelchair bracket through a bearing, two ends of the shaft are respectively rotatably provided with a chair wheel, universal wheels and pedals, and a wheelchair backrest, wherein the wheelchair backrest comprises a chair back bracket, the chair back bracket is provided with a backrest cushion, the chair back bracket consists of two chair back support rods, the middle part of each chair back support rod is rotatably connected with the wheelchair bracket through a connecting piece, the top end of the chair back support rod is horizontally bent back to form a holding rod, and a handle is sleeved on the holding rod; the bottom end of the chair back support rod is connected with the wheelchair bracket through an angle adjusting mechanism so as to adjust the angle of the chair back through the angle adjusting mechanism. Therefore, the operation is simple and convenient, and the requirements of users can be better met.

Detailed Description
In the description of the present utility model, it should be understood that the terms "upper", "lower", "front", "rear", "left", "right", "top", "bottom", "inner", "outer", etc. indicate orientations or positional relationships based on the orientations or positional relationships shown in the drawings, are merely for convenience in describing the present utility model and simplifying the description, and do not indicate or imply that the components referred to must have a specific orientation, and specific orientation configuration and operation, and it is possible for those skilled in the art to specifically understand the specific meanings of the above terms in the present utility model, and thus should not be construed as limiting the present utility model. The present utility model will be described in further detail with reference to the accompanying drawings.
As shown in fig. 1 and 2, the embodiment provides a multifunctional medical care chair, which comprises a wheelchair bracket 1, a seat cushion 2, a shaft rotatably mounted on the wheelchair bracket through a bearing, a chair wheel 3, universal wheels 4 and pedals 5, a wheelchair backrest 6, a backrest cushion, a backrest support and a handle 62, wherein the wheelchair bracket is provided with a seat cushion and consists of two backrest struts 61, the middle part of each backrest strut is rotatably connected with the wheelchair bracket through a connecting piece (a bolt or a rivet, and the like), the top end of each backrest strut is horizontally bent back to form a holding rod, and the holding rod is sleeved with the handle 62; the bottom end of the chair back support rod is connected with the wheelchair bracket through an angle adjusting mechanism so as to adjust the angle of the chair back through the angle adjusting mechanism.
According to the utility model, the two chair back support rods of the wheelchair backrest are respectively connected with the wheelchair bracket in a rotating way through the connecting piece, the bottom ends of the chair back support rods are connected with the wheelchair bracket through the angle adjusting mechanism, so that the angle between the chair back support rods and the wheelchair bracket is adjusted through the angle adjusting mechanism, the included angle between the wheelchair backrest and the wheelchair bracket is changed, and the angle of the wheelchair backrest is adjusted. The patient can sit on the wheelchair at a proper angle, so that the patient is prevented from sitting on the wheelchair for a long time, the stress on the buttocks and the thighs of the patient is reduced, and the generation of ache and numbness is avoided. The wheelchair is convenient for a short rest, and the use requirement of a patient is met.
In this embodiment, the specific structure of the angle adjusting mechanism is: comprises a regulating pipe 7 which is horizontally and longitudinally arranged on a wheelchair bracket (in the travelling direction of the wheelchair), a regulating rod 8 is arranged in the regulating pipe in a sliding way, and one end of the regulating rod, which is close to a chair back supporting rod, is hinged with the chair back supporting rod; positioning holes 9 are respectively formed in the outer peripheral surfaces of the adjusting pipes and the adjusting rods in a one-to-one correspondence manner, wherein the adjusting pipes are provided with a plurality of positioning holes, and the positioning holes are uniformly formed at intervals along the length direction of the adjusting pipes; the locating pin is arranged in the locating hole of the adjusting rod, the locating pin is provided with a fixed end and a telescopic end, the fixed end of the locating pin is arranged in the locating hole of the adjusting rod, and the telescopic end of the locating pin is pressed to penetrate out of the corresponding locating hole on the adjusting pipe so as to adjust the angle of the wheelchair backrest.
When the wheelchair is used, after a patient sits on the wheelchair, the back of the patient is abutted against the backrest cushion, the telescopic end of the locating pin is pressed by hands, and the adjusting rod axially moves in the adjusting pipe, so that the telescopic end of the locating pin penetrates out of the corresponding locating hole on the adjusting pipe, and the angle of the backrest of the wheelchair is adjusted; the angle of the chair backrest increases along with the number of the corresponding positioning holes on the positioning pin extending end penetrating out of the adjusting pipe.
It should be further noted that, in addition to the above structure, the angle adjusting mechanism may also adopt other structures, for example: an adjusting pipe is horizontally and longitudinally arranged on the wheelchair bracket, an adjusting rod is arranged in the adjusting pipe in a sliding manner, and one end of the adjusting rod, which is close to the chair back support rod, is hinged with the chair back support rod; the outer peripheral surfaces of the adjusting pipes and the adjusting rods are respectively provided with a plurality of positioning holes in a one-to-one correspondence mode, and the positioning holes of the adjusting pipes are uniformly formed in the length direction of the adjusting pipes at intervals. When the adjusting pipe is opposite to the positioning hole on the adjusting rod, the adjusting pipe can be locked by the nut after passing through the positioning hole through the bolt.
After the back angle of the wheelchair is adjusted, the wheelchair is convenient to reset for the back angle of the wheelchair, and is convenient for medical staff or family members to push the wheelchair to run. In the embodiment, one end of the adjusting pipe 7 far away from the wheelchair bracket is provided with an internal thread and is connected with a bolt in a threaded manner; a spring is arranged in the adjusting pipe, one end of the spring is abutted with the bolt, and the other end of the spring is abutted with the adjusting rod so as to reset the angle of the wheelchair backrest through spring rebound.
Therefore, after the angle of the backrest of the wheelchair is adjusted, the spring is in a pressed state, the telescopic end of the positioning pin is pressed, the spring pushes the adjusting rod to reversely slide in the adjusting pipe to penetrate through the corresponding positioning hole on the adjusting pipe, and the angle of the backrest of the wheelchair is gradually reset.
In order to facilitate the pressing of the positioning pin, the adjustment of the backrest angle of the wheelchair is rapidly realized. In the embodiment, a chute 10 for communicating all positioning holes of the adjusting tube is axially and penetratingly arranged on the peripheral surface of the adjusting tube 7, a sleeve 11 is sleeved on the adjusting tube, a convex strip matched with the chute is radially formed on the inner wall of the sleeve in a protruding way, and edges and corners at two ends of the convex strip are rounded or chamfered so as to axially move the sleeve and retract a part of telescopic ends of the positioning pins; the installation hole penetrating through the convex strip is formed in the outer peripheral surface of the sleeve, the installation hole is provided with a reset pin, the reset pin is provided with a fixed end and a telescopic end, a reset spring is arranged in the telescopic end of the reset pin, the fixed end of the reset pin is installed in the installation hole, and the telescopic end of the reset pin is in butt joint with the bottom of the chute groove.
Therefore, when the sleeve axially moves on the adjusting pipe, the telescopic end of the reset pin is abutted with the telescopic end of the positioning pin, so that the telescopic end of the positioning pin is retracted partially, the adjusting rod is stressed and axially moves in the adjusting pipe, and the angle of the backrest of the wheelchair is quickly adjusted.
Referring to fig. 2, when the backrest angle of the wheelchair is realized, the stress of the buttocks and the thighs of a patient is relieved, and the problem that the thighs of the patient are ache and numb after sitting for a long time is further reduced. The embodiment is also provided with a massage mechanism, which is specifically as follows:
The seat cushion 2 comprises a seat plate 21 and a cushion 22 with elasticity, wherein the cushion 22 is arranged on the upper surface of the seat plate, the lower surface of the seat plate is provided with a mounting groove, a rotating shaft 23 and a motor 24 are rotatably arranged in the mounting groove, an output shaft of the motor is connected with a key of the rotating shaft, an input end of the motor is connected with an output end of a controller through a lead, so that the controller is used for controlling the starting and stopping of the motor, arc-shaped protruding parts 25 are radially protruded on the peripheral surface of the rotating shaft, a plurality of arc-shaped protruding parts are arranged, and the arc-shaped protruding parts are uniformly arranged at axial intervals; massage holes corresponding to the arc-shaped protruding parts in one-to-one correspondence are formed in the upper surface of the seat plate, massage columns 26 are slidably arranged in the massage holes, massage springs are sleeved on the massage columns, the bottom ends of the massage columns are abutted to the arc-shaped protruding parts, and the top ends of the massage columns extend out of the massage holes and are provided with rubber tops.
During the use, through controller control motor start, motor accessible battery power supply, motor drive pivot, pivot epaxial arc bulge axial rotation, arc bulge have minimum and highest point to promote massage and slide, massage spring is pressed, and the cushion surface bulge, after the massage post slides arc bulge highest point, massage spring is kick-backed, and the massage post resets, so just realizes massaging patient's thigh repeatedly, thereby further reduces patient's thigh and produces the problem of ache, numbness after sitting for a long time.
Referring to fig. 1, in order to facilitate the patient to obtain good support for the waist after adjusting the angle of the backrest of the wheelchair. In the embodiment, the backrest cushion is provided with the air bag, the air bag is provided with an air inlet, an air pipe communicated with the air bag is arranged at the air inlet of the air bag, and the air inlet of the air pipe is connected with an inflator pump so as to inflate the air bag through the inflator pump.
Like this, through inlay the gasbag that corresponds with patient's waist position in the back pad, can obtain fine bearing to the waist when making the patient lie on the wheelchair rest, the gasbag passes through trachea and inflator pump intercommunication, can control the state of aerifing of gasbag as required, convenient to use has improved patient's rest's personnel's travelling comfort greatly.
Referring to fig. 1, in order to facilitate good ventilation and heat dissipation to the buttocks of a patient, in this embodiment, side guard plates 12 are vertically disposed on the left and right sides of the wheelchair frame, and a plurality of ventilation holes 13 are uniformly formed on the surface of the side guard plates at intervals, so as to facilitate ventilation and heat dissipation. So that the patient sits on the seat
To facilitate the arm placement of the patient, armrests 14 are symmetrically disposed on the wheelchair frame in this embodiment, respectively, to facilitate the arm placement. Thus, when the patient needs to rest, the arm is placed on the armrest, so that the patient can be relaxed.
